The City Council Committee of the Whole agenda for August 1, 2022, is published. While a noticeable improvement has occurred in the closed session citations of the specifically allowed exception in the Open Meetings Act, the August 1 agenda has the same stinker that was deployed during the Emma’s Landing debacle. Several OMA violations occurred during that process. But here is the Warning: The August 1 agenda cites an incorrect exception again because the word “sale” has been incorrectly inserted into 5 ILCS 120/2(c)(5). The sale of city-owned real property cannot be discussed in a secret session except for the specific purpose of setting the sale or lease price. In the Emma’s Landing sale of public property, many issues besides selling price were discussed secretly. Examples have been cited in other posts on this site. 5 ILCS 120/2 – Illinois General Assembly

(5) The purchase or lease of real property for the
use of the public body, including meetings held for the purpose of discussing whether a particular parcel should be acquired.
(6) The setting of a price for sale or lease of
    property owned by the public body.

Here is the agenda item for the COW meeting of August 1, 2022:

  1. Closed Session on Probable Litigation (5 ILCS 120/2(c)(11) and the Purchase, Sale,
    or Lease of Real Property for the Use of the Public Body (5 ILCS 120/2(c)(5)

This is not a trivial point of order. Fraudulent documents have been recorded by the City of Geneva and by the mayor personally, that pertain to the deed for Emma’s Landing. These frauds originated in closed sessions, for the most part. ILCS 120/2(c)(6) is the very specific “sale” exception.
